Ginger Pepper Steak

Transport your taste buds to the Orient with this quick-cooking steak and bell peppers in a flavorful ginger sauce.
1 Picture
Ingredients
- 1 package brown gravy mix
- 3/4 cup cold water
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ce
- 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 1 pound boneless beef sirloin steak, cut into thin strips
- 1 small onion, cut into thin wedges
- 1 medium green or red bell pepper (or 1/2 of each), cut into thin strips
- Cooked rice

Preparation
Step 1
1. Mix Gravy Mix, water, soy sauce and ginger in small bowl until well blended.
2. Heat oil in large skillet on medium-high heat. Add steak; cook and stir 2 minutes or until no longer pink. Stir in gravy mixture, onion and bell pepper.
3. Bring to boil. Reduce heat to low; simmer 6 to 8 minutes or until sauce is thickened, stirring occasionally. Serve over cooked rice, if desired.

TEST KITCHEN TIPS:
Prepare as directed, using 1/4 teaspoon ground red pepper in place of the ground ginger.
Use 1 bag (16 ounces) frozen pepper stir-fry blend in place of the onion and bell pepper.
